研究概览
简要总结
Growth Hormone (GH) deficiency, defined by insufficient GH response to a variety of stimulating compounds, is found in 20-35% of adults who suffer traumatic brain injuries (TBI) requiring inpatient rehabilitation1. However, there is no accepted gold standard for diagnosing GH deficiency in this population. Further, the major effector molecule of the somatotropic axis, Insulin-Like Growth Factor-1 (IGF-1) has recently been recognized as an important neurotrophic agent. Since most repair and regeneration after TBI occurs within the first few months after injury, absolute or relative deficiencies of GH and IGF-1 in the subacute period after TBI are potentially important factors why some patients fail to make a good functional recovery. The proposed study is a randomized, double-blind, placebo-controlled trial of rhGH, starting at 1 month post TBI, continuing for 6 months.
This study has one primary hypothesis, that treatment with recombinant human Growth Hormone (rhGH) in the subacute period after TBI results in improved functional outcome 6 months after injury. As secondary hypotheses, we will investigate what is the optimal method to diagnose GH deficiency in TBI survivors and study the relationship between GH deficiency and insufficiency and functional recovery.
详细描述
- Patient selection and enrollment. Participants will be recruited into the study from subjects admitted for acute inpatient rehabilitation in the North Texas Traumatic Brain Injury Model Systems (NT-TBIMS) affiliated rehabilitation units. Our goal is to enroll participants who have the potential for neuroregeneration, but who suffered a sufficiently severe injury that the chance of full recovery (to normal pre-injury function) is low. Over a 4 year enrollment period, we plan to randomize 168 subjects into the study (with the anticipation that 71 will complete each arm of the trial).

排除标准
- •History of pre-existing neurologic disease (such as epilepsy, brain tumors, meningitis, cerebral palsy, encephalitis, brain abscesses, vascular malformations, cerebrovascular disease, Alzheimer's disease, multiple sclerosis, or HIV-encephalitis)
- •History of premorbid disabling condition that interfere with outcome assessments
- •Contraindication to rhGH therapy. (hypersensitivity to rhGH or any of the components of the supplied product, including metacresol, glycerin, or benzyl alcohol)
- •Penetrating traumatic brain injury
- •Diabetes mellitus.
- •Obesity (BMI > 30).
- •Active infection.
- •Active malignant disease.
- •Acute critical illness, heart failure, or acute respiratory failure
- •Previous hospitalization for TBI > 1 day
- •Membership in a vulnerable population (prisoner)
- •Pregnancy. Women of childbearing age will be given a pregnancy test during screening to exclude pregnancy.
- •Lactating females
研究组 & 干预措施
1
The GH treatment arm will receive a starting dose of 400 microgramsg/day, with increases (or decreases) in dose by 100-200 micrograms/day each month, monitoring for side effects, until goal IGF-1 (in the upper quartile of the range for age and body weight) is reached up to maximum dose of 1,000 microgramsg/day. Dose adjustments may be modified by the investigators for participants receiving oral estrogens or other circumstances know to influence GH dosing or atypical responses to treatment.
干预措施: Recombinant human Growth Hormone (Drug)
2
Doses for participants receiving placebo will also be adjusted monthly to maintain the blinding.
干预措施: Placebo (Drug)
结局指标
主要结局
Functional Outcome 6 Months After Injury, as Measured by the Processing Speed Index
时间窗: 6 months
Processing Speed Index ages standardized score. In this scale, higher scores represent better functioning, lower scores represent poorer function. 100 = mean of a normative population. 110 = 1 standard deviation above normal; 90 = 1 standard deviation below normal 120 = 2 standard deviations above normal; 80 = 2 standard deviations below normal
